Essential Pruning Techniques for Falls Church Trees
Effective tree pruning requires knowledge and skill. Here are some essential techniques to ensure your trees receive the care they need:
Identify the Tree’s Purpose
Before beginning any pruning, understand why you’re pruning. Is it for maintenance, shaping, or to encourage fruit growth? Different purposes require different approaches.
Use Proper Tools
Invest in high-quality pruning shears, loppers, and saws suitable for your tree size. Sharp tools ensure clean cuts, reducing stress on the tree. Dull blades can leave stubs and promote disease entry points.
Make Clean Cuts
Always make clean cuts just outside the branch collar (the swollen area where a branch joins the trunk). Avoid leaving large stubs, as they can be an entry point for pests and diseases.
Remove Dead or Diseased Branches
Prioritize removing any dead, diseased, or damaged branches first. This prevents the spread of infections and improves overall tree health.
Thinning and Shaping
Thinning involves removing entire branches back to a lateral branch or to the trunk. This increases air circulation and light penetration. Shaping focuses on selectively removing branches to achieve a specific form.
